> I was wondering wether it was punishable or not to kill while defending one's
> tula against raiders from another Orlanthi clan. In this case, does wergild
> apply or not?
>
> The defender was a humakti gest who was fighting alone against six people
> (including a weaponthane).
>
> Thanks for any clarification.
I think you're making a fundemental mistake here. A guest who helps defend his host's property and kills in the process is not a murderer. Perhaps there might be grounds for fueding if the killing were particularly brutal, surrenders were refused etc, but even then, that's what you get if you pick a fight with a Humakti.
